Output ef6f2fb3b14aadff0a9500edb1c60c80acf3e0f951cc4001cf6c4f30ae5d9bd3:0

value
71588569
script pubkey
OP_HASH160 OP_PUSHBYTES_20 51042222ce2bb2ad69367dd664a00740a9a8936f OP_EQUAL
address
395PcGiUH4NjNaY9L8ZVJANHufHB276yUa
transaction
ef6f2fb3b14aadff0a9500edb1c60c80acf3e0f951cc4001cf6c4f30ae5d9bd3
confirmations
475070
spent
true